As the manager/primary maintainer of Trinity, Community feedback is important to me. While I may not always reply, I do read every single post, and take each idea seriously. I also try to prioritize things by the more posts I see on the same problem or idea.

In trying to think of a better way to do this - collect your ideas and feedback - then prioritize as needed - I would like to try something new, where a simple Forum Poll wouldn't work - since I want the ideas to be sourced from the community, ranked, and ordered in terms of most important to least important.

I setup a community space on Reddit that I'd like to try:

http://www.reddit.com/r/DBTrinity/

The concept is:

  • Create a post, either a text post with your idea, or provide a link to a forum post that you think should be prioritized
  • If you don't have any ideas, you can upvote or downvote others ideas and bug fixes
  • It can be a bug
  • It can be an idea for a new feature
  • The more detail provided, the faster it will likely get resolved, fixed, or created
The reason I chose reddit is because it's anonymous and free. Anyone, in any country, can sign up for an account - all you need is an email address (which won't be shared!) Read more about reddit.

You can also use this thread for feedback on this idea (discuss using Reddit for community feedback).

Please don't use this thread for Trinity ideas themselves - put those in the proper place (for example, in a Trinity release thread, or in your own thread!)

Reddit allows users to vote on multiple items - where a Forum Poll only allows a single vote on a single item.

Reddit also allows users to submit their own items - where Forum Poll choices are purely controlled by myself.

If the forum had these two capabilities, then I wouldn't need a separate system.
